Areas Served

The Southeast Minnesota Heartland Chapter of the Preventive Cardiovascular Nursing Association serves Rochester and the surrounding towns of Kasson, Byron, Lake City, Red Wing, Owatonna, Austin, Albert Lea, Waseca, Mankato, Cannon Falls, Fairmont, Winona, and St. Peter. Chapter Introduction

The Southeast Minnesota Heartland Chapter of the Preventive Cardiovascular Nursing Association was founded in 2019 by Kate Nilges, RN-BSN, to bring further awareness and education on cardiovascular disease to the area.

Our chapter strives to promote professional development and networking among cardiovascular professionals in our area, as well as nationwide. We aim to increase awareness regarding cardiovascular disease and further educate ourselves and our peers on the newest preventive and therapeutic modalities. We hold educational programs in the fall and spring and highly encourage attendance at the Annual Symposium, as this is a great opportunity to learn together and network within our ever-growing field.
